Assorted Shades of Brown Afghan
Today I begin working on my Assorted Shades of Brown blanket. I had started some squares at the end of 2012, but don’t really like how they look. So, I looked through one of my vintage crochet books and found two motifs that I will be adapting into 7 inch squares.

These motifs will also be swapped at the end of January.
Swap requirements :
Must be made to measure 7 inches / approx. 18 cm
Made using 4 ply worsted weight acrylic yarn
Color: shades of brown (all shades welcome)
Day 1 of 28: (Jan 5) Make sample motifs. If they turn out okay, begin making 18 of each design.
